High-End Bosch Dishwashers: Silence and Performance

The Bosch 800 Series and 900 Series are the crème de la crème of Bosch dishwashers, offering unparalleled silence and performance. These high-end models feature advanced noise-reducing technology, ensuring that your kitchen remains quiet and peaceful during operation.

  • The Bosch 800 Series models come equipped with the UltraQuiet 39 dBA sound level, making them ideal for open-plan kitchens.
  • The 900 Series models take it a step further with the UltraQuiet 38 dBA sound level, ensuring that your dishwasher operates almost silently.

Mid-Range Bosch Dishwashers: Balance and Affordability

The Bosch 500 Series and 600 Series offer a perfect balance of performance, features, and affordability. These mid-range models are designed to provide reliable cleaning and convenience without breaking the bank.

  • The Bosch 500 Series models feature advanced wash systems, ensuring that your dishes come out sparkling clean.
  • The 600 Series models offer additional features like third-level racks and adjustable tines, providing more flexibility and convenience.

Entry-Level Bosch Dishwashers: Budget-Friendly Options

The Bosch 100 Series and 200 Series are budget-friendly options that still deliver reliable performance and cleaning power. These entry-level models are perfect for those on a tight budget or for small households.

Regular Cleaning and Filter Maintenance

Cleaning your Bosch dishwasher’s filters and interior regularly can help remove grease, food particles, and debris that can clog the system and reduce efficiency. For example, the Bosch 300 Series dishwasher features a self-cleaning filter that can be easily rinsed under the sink, but it’s still crucial to inspect and clean the filter every 1-2 months. Additionally, the interior of your dishwasher should be wiped down with a soft cloth and mild detergent after each use to prevent the buildup of stubborn food residue.

  • Replace the water softener or salt as recommended by the manufacturer to prevent mineral buildup and maintain water quality.
  • Run a cleaning cycle on your Bosch dishwasher every 1-3 months to remove any built-up grime and odors.

Identifying and Addressing Common Issues

Common issues like faulty sensors, clogged drains, or worn-out seals can be easily identified and resolved with the right troubleshooting techniques. For instance, if your Bosch dishwasher is not completing a cycle, check the drain pump filter for blockages or consult the user manual for guidance on resetting the appliance. If you’re still unsure, contact Bosch customer support or a professional appliance technician for assistance. (See Also:Reset Samsung Dishwasher Dw80r2031us)

Preventative Maintenance and Upgrades

To maximize the lifespan of your Bosch dishwasher and ensure optimal performance, consider upgrading to a high-efficiency water softener or installing a smart water filter that can detect mineral levels and alert you to maintenance needs. Regularly inspect your dishwasher’s door seals, gaskets, and hinges for signs of wear and tear, and replace them as needed to prevent leaks and water damage.

Which Bosch Dishwasher Model is Better: the 300 Series or the 500 Series?

The Bosch 500 Series offers more advanced features and improved performance compared to the 300 Series. The 500 Series includes features like the “PrecisionWash” system, which uses sensors to detect soil levels and adjust water temperature and cycle time accordingly. Additionally, the 500 Series often comes with more customizable settings and improved noise reduction. However, the 300 Series is still a reliable and efficient option, offering a more affordable entry point into the Bosch brand. (See Also:I Put Nutribullet Dishwasher)
